[Pkg-virtualbox-commits] r32 - trunk/debian

pwinnertz-guest at alioth.debian.org pwinnertz-guest at alioth.debian.org
Wed Sep 5 22:07:23 UTC 2007


Author: pwinnertz-guest
Date: 2007-09-05 22:07:22 +0000 (Wed, 05 Sep 2007)
New Revision: 32

Modified:
   trunk/debian/changelog
   trunk/debian/control
   trunk/debian/rules
Log:
prepare for 1.5.0 upload


Modified: trunk/debian/changelog
===================================================================
--- trunk/debian/changelog	2007-09-05 21:44:38 UTC (rev 31)
+++ trunk/debian/changelog	2007-09-05 22:07:22 UTC (rev 32)
@@ -1,4 +1,4 @@
-virtualbox-ose (1.5.0-dfsg2-1) UNRELEASED; urgency=low
+virtualbox-ose (1.5.0-dfsg2-1) unstable; urgency=low
 
   * Improved README.Debian for virtualbox-ose-source (Closes: #440793 )
   * Fixed error using different kernel sourcen than the one which is running

Modified: trunk/debian/control
===================================================================
--- trunk/debian/control	2007-09-05 21:44:38 UTC (rev 31)
+++ trunk/debian/control	2007-09-05 22:07:22 UTC (rev 32)
@@ -38,3 +38,25 @@
  Linux, FreeBSD, DOS, OpenBSD and others.
  .
   Homepage: <http://www.virtualbox.org/>
+
+Package: virtualbox-ose-guest-utils
+Architecture: amd64 i386
+Depends: ${shlibs:Depends}, ${misc:Depends}
+Recommends: virtualbox-ose-guest-modules, virtualbox-ose-guest-source
+Description: Utilitlies for Guest Hosts
+ Ths packages contains several utilities which could be needed on a Debian
+ guest host. E.g. in order to m ount shared-folders or to use the clipboard.
+ .
+ This package is not meant to be installed on a normal Debian System, only on 
+ Debian Hosts inside of virtualbox.
+ .
+  Homepage: <http://www.virtualbox.org/>
+
+Package: virtualbox-ose-guest-source
+Architecture: all
+Depends: debhelper (>=5 ), dpatch, module-assistant, bzip2, kbuild
+Description: Source for the VirtualBox Guest modules
+ This package provides the source code for the virtualbox kernel modules for guest
+ systems. Kernel source or headers are required in order to compile these modules.
+ .
+  Homepage: <http://www.virtualbox.org/>

Modified: trunk/debian/rules
===================================================================
--- trunk/debian/rules	2007-09-05 21:44:38 UTC (rev 31)
+++ trunk/debian/rules	2007-09-05 22:07:22 UTC (rev 32)
@@ -9,10 +9,13 @@
 #
 # Name of the source package
 psource:=virtualbox-ose-source
+gsource:=virtualbox-ose-guest-source
 
 # The short upstream name, used for the module source directory
 sname:=virtualbox-ose
 
+uname:=virtualbox-ose-guest-utils
+
 ### KERNEL SETUP
 ### Setup the stuff needed for making kernel module packages
 ### taken from /usr/share/kernel-package/sample.module.rules
@@ -125,10 +128,17 @@
 	mkdir -p debian/$(psource)/usr/src/modules
 	mv debian/$(sname)/usr/lib/virtualbox/src debian/$(psource)/usr/src/modules/$(sname)
 
+	mkdir -p debian/$(gsource)/usr/src/modules
+	mv debian/$(sname)/usr/lib/virtualbox/additions/ debian/$(gsource)/usr/src/modules/$(sname)-guest
+
 	mkdir -p debian/$(psource)/usr/src/modules/$(sname)/debian
-	cp debian/*modules.in* debian/control debian/rules debian/changelog debian/copyright debian/compat  debian/$(psource)/usr/src/modules/$(sname)/debian
+	cp debian/*.modules.in* debian/control debian/rules debian/changelog debian/copyright debian/compat  debian/$(psource)/usr/src/modules/$(sname)/debian
 
+	mkdir -p debian/$(gsource)/usr/src/modules/$(sname)-guest/debian
+	cp debian/*.guestmodules.in* debian/control debian/rules debian/changelog debian/copyright debian/compat debian/$(gsource)/usr/src/modules/$(sname)-guest/debian
+
 	cd debian/$(psource)/usr/src && tar c modules | bzip2 -9 > $(sname).tar.bz2 && rm -rf modules
+	cd debian/$(gsource)/usr/src && tar c modules | bzip2 -9 > $(sname)-guest.tar.bz2 && rm -rf modules
 
 	dh_install
 




More information about the Pkg-virtualbox-commits mailing list